Celebrating Powerful Testimony & Representation of Community Action on Capitol Hill

This morning, I had the pleasure of watching the Labor, Health and Human Services, and Education – Public Witness Day hearing held at the Capitol. I’m extremely proud to share that one of the witnesses was our very own Jennifer Carroll, Assistant Director at the Community Action Partnership of North Alabama, where Tim Thrasher serves as CEO.

Jennifer delivered a powerful and compelling testimony that not only highlighted the critical importance of the Head Start program, but also painted a clear and passionate picture of the impact Community Action continues to make across our communities. Her voice was steady, her message was strong, and her presence was a shining example of the professionalism and heart that define our network.

One moment that stood out was the response from Representative Rosa DeLauro, who offered heartfelt comments on Jennifer’s testimony. Her remarks emphasized the vital role Head Start plays and underscored her deep respect for Community Action Agencies and the work we do daily to uplift children, families, and communities.
